Here are some lessons … The Standard chainsaw chain sequence features have the most teeth allowing for extremely smooth woodcuts. A standard chain is also described as a full skip chain on a larger bar. Standard chainsaw cutters are designed to handle large logs and trees that require this type of chainsaw equipment.

WebTeeth Diameter. The first item you need to know for sharpening is the cutting teeth diameter and angle. Teeth diameter is also the size of the file you will need to sharpen the teeth. Many blades use a diameter around 5/32” (4mm) 3/16” (4.75mm) or 7/32” (5.5mm). But there again, this can be different with your blade.
